Describe the educational and informational objective of the program and how it meets the definition of Core Programming
|
|
Propelled by his own wonderful imagination, Nini takes children on enchanting journeys in Oooberryland, encouraging friendship, learning, cooperation, investigative skills, critical thought, organizing knowledge and a love of reading. Every episode concludes with a problem solved, a friendship strengthened, a giggle and a laugh.

Describe the educational and informational objective of the program and how it meets the definition of Core Programming
|
|
Agua Viva is an entertainment, educational and musical program that tell the adventures of a brother and sister whose toys come to life in Agua Viva. Its a beautiful place where they not only have fun, but also have an opportunity to play, create and learn together with their friends who help them understand the importance of love, honesty and friendship. As they confront daily problems, they develop good character and a positive attitude towards life.

Describe the educational and informational objective of the program and how it meets the definition of Core Programming
|
|
Live-action, kid-hosted show with a variety of segments that foster cognitive and social development. Winner of seven international awards, Bizbirije encourages children to create new ideas while having fun engaging in art projects, magic tricks, songs, science experiments and ideas to save the planet.

Describe the educational and informational objective of the program and how it meets the definition of Core Programming
|
|
Nico is a series designed to make children think about the rehabilitation and integration of disabled people in modern society, combining such messages with the adventure which each episode presents. From historical backgrounds to scientific and medical facts, the world of the blind is told in an entertaining, lighthearted way that all children can relate to and teaches children that blind kids are just like any other kid.

Describe the educational and informational objective of the program and how it meets the definition of Core Programming
|
|
Dragon Tales is designed to increase childrens collection of strategies to deal with the everyday challenges of growing up. It encourages young children to pursue the challenging experiences that support their growth and development. It helps young children recognize that there are many ways to approach and learn from the challenging experiences in their lives and that to try and not succeed fully is a natural and valuable part of learning.
